Output 2864bae2fdd97228f2909e9f4f759adc3252f4306f9881cdf3b5c684b692253a:0

value
133536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d9b6479ac79444737ff20acd479caa8f599e21 OP_EQUAL
address
MLecxzUCRKCtfPzwxwtEPV2vKG9S7GMN56
transaction
2864bae2fdd97228f2909e9f4f759adc3252f4306f9881cdf3b5c684b692253a
spent
true